Oppo Find N5 Launch Date Announced; Leaked Screenshot Reveals Key Specifications

The Oppo Find N5, the next iteration in Oppo’s foldable smartphone lineup, is set to make its debut in global markets next week. After teasing the device for some time, the company has confirmed that the launch will happen on February 20 in Singapore, with the device making its way to China and other regions simultaneously. The Oppo Find N5 will be an exciting step forward in the world of foldables, with a 3D-printed titanium alloy hinge expected to provide durability while maintaining a sleek design. Additionally, a triple-camera setup on the outside is expected to deliver impressive photography capabilities for users.

The official event will kick off at 7 p.m. local time in Singapore, or 4:30 p.m. IST, marking the global unveiling. While Oppo has revealed the color options for the device, the global launch event’s teaser video seems to omit the Twilight Purple variant, which may only be available in China. Instead, the Oppo Find N5 will come in Jade White and Satin Black color options, giving potential buyers a glimpse of the stylish and modern design the device is expected to feature.

Leaked specifications of the Oppo Find N5 suggest that it will be powered by Qualcomm’s Snapdragon 8 Elite chip, offering significant performance improvements. The device will feature an impressive 16GB of RAM, which can be virtually expanded with up to 12GB of unused storage, providing plenty of power for multitasking and running demanding applications. For users who need storage, the phone will offer 512GB of internal space, allowing for a large number of apps, photos, and media.

One of the standout features of the Oppo Find N5 will be its camera setup, with a triple camera system on the exterior of the foldable device. The 50-megapixel primary camera will be complemented by two additional 50-megapixel and 8-megapixel sensors, which are expected to be used for telephoto and ultrawide photography. Additionally, the device will feature dual 8-megapixel cameras, one on the cover screen and one on the inner display, providing a comprehensive range of camera capabilities for both photo and video enthusiasts.

Apple Patents Innovative Hinge Design for Foldable Devices Featuring Interlocked Fingers and Friction Clutch Mechanism

Apple has recently secured a patent for an innovative hinge design aimed at foldable devices, signaling the company’s continued exploration into foldable screen technology. While Apple has yet to release its first foldable device, this patent suggests that the company is actively working on creating foldable smartphones, tablets, and even computers. This marks a significant step in the company’s development, especially as its competitors, such as Samsung and Huawei, have already launched their own foldable models with multi-display setups. Apple’s design focuses on creating a reliable and functional hinge that could enhance the durability and user experience of foldable devices.

The hinge mechanism described in the patent is designed to prevent excessive rotation, offering a solution to one of the main concerns in foldable device design: durability. According to the patent, the hinge consists of several interconnected links that rotate relative to each other, enabling the folding and unfolding of the device. This movement is controlled through a friction clutch mechanism, which features interlocked ‘fingers’ that fit into crescent-shaped slots. This setup ensures that the device’s hinge does not extend beyond a certain limit, which could potentially damage the flexible display or affect the device’s longevity.

The design also includes a flexible display divided into two sections, which would bend around the axis of the hinge. This configuration suggests that Apple may be aiming to create foldable devices that maintain a seamless and consistent user experience when transitioning between the device’s unfolded and folded states. The patent further outlines that the hinge is designed to maintain smooth motion while preventing unnecessary strain on the display, which is essential for the long-term use of foldable gadgets.

Although Apple has not confirmed any product release date, this patent is a clear indication of the company’s efforts to catch up with the growing foldable market. By refining the hinge design and focusing on durability, Apple may be preparing to enter the foldable device space with a product that addresses some of the common challenges faced by current models. If successful, this innovation could pave the way for more refined, long-lasting foldable devices in the future, allowing Apple to bring its own unique offerings to the foldable category.

Huawei’s New Foldable Smartphone with Integrated Case and Rectangular Design Revealed in Patent Filing

Huawei may be developing a new foldable smartphone with a unique design that features an attached protective cover. According to a patent published on the China National Intellectual Property Administration (CNIPA) website, the company is exploring the possibility of integrating a cover directly into the foldable device itself. Images provided in the patent suggest that the phone could be a tri-fold model, with the outermost panel serving as a protective cover when the device is closed. This follows Huawei’s recent release of the Mate XT Ultimate Design, the world’s first commercially available tri-fold phone, further indicating the company’s push to innovate in the foldable market.

The patent outlines a device that could function both as a smartphone and a tablet, incorporating a flexible hinge mechanism that allows the device to unfold and transform into a larger display. The protective cover is designed to wrap around the foldable sections of the device, providing added durability when the device is folded. This solution would help safeguard the fragile display without adding bulk, as the cover is described as being slim and lightweight, reducing the overall size of the phone.

This innovative concept aims to offer both practicality and style, addressing the potential downsides of foldable phones, such as screen damage or durability concerns. By integrating the cover into the design, Huawei could simplify the user experience by eliminating the need for a separate case while providing enhanced protection. The foldable’s hinge and frame design will likely be engineered to ensure smooth operation, with the cover remaining flexible to adapt to the device’s movements.

While still in the patent phase, this foldable phone concept could set the stage for Huawei’s next generation of foldable smartphones, continuing the trend of offering versatile devices with cutting-edge features. The design’s emphasis on reducing the overall footprint while still providing functionality suggests that Huawei is thinking strategically about the future of foldable technology. If the concept moves forward, it could provide a more streamlined and durable option for consumers in the growing foldable phone market.
